What is On-Page SEO?
So, what exactly is On-Page SEO? It refers to the practices used to optimize individual web pages in order to rank higher and earn more relevant traffic from search engines. It’s all about getting YOUR website optimized for SEO. This does NOT include social media, directories, and backlinks – that’s what we call Off-Page SEO.
Keyword Optimization
One of the key elements of On-Page SEO is keyword optimization. This involves conducting thorough research to identify the keywords that your target audience is using when searching for contractors or construction services online. These keywords should be strategically placed throughout your website’s content, including in the page titles, headings, meta descriptions, and body text.
Website Image Optimization
Another crucial aspect of On-Page SEO is optimizing your website’s images. This includes using alt tags to describe images for better accessibility and adding relevant keywords to your image file names. Additionally, compressing images can improve your website’s loading speed, which is another important factor for SEO.
Website Struture
It’s also important to have a well-organized website structure with clear navigation. This not only makes it easier for visitors to find what they’re looking for, but it also helps search engines crawl and index your website more efficiently. Consider creating a sitemap and ensuring that each page on your website is easily accessible through internal links.
Quality Content
In addition to these technical aspects, On-Page SEO also involves creating high-quality, relevant, and engaging content. This not only helps to attract and retain visitors but also signals to search engines that your website is a valuable resource for users. Regularly updating your website with fresh, informative content can also improve its ranking in search results.
Measure & Monitor Your Contractor Website
Lastly, it’s important to regularly monitor and analyze your website’s performance and make adjustments as needed. This can include tracking keyword rankings, website traffic, and user engagement to identify areas for improvement.
